History of Brown Dye
The use of brown dye dates back to ancient civilizations, where it was used to color fabrics, leathers, and other materials. In ancient Egypt, for example, brown dye was used to color linen garments and other textiles. The Egyptians used a combination of natural ingredients, including plants, minerals, and insects, to create a range of brown shades. Similarly, in ancient Greece and Rome, brown dye was used to color woolen garments and other fabrics.
Natural Ingredients Used in Ancient Times
In ancient times, brown dye was created using a variety of natural ingredients, including:
- Plants: Certain plants, such as walnut husks, pomegranate rinds, and onion skins, were used to create different shades of brown.
- Minerals: Minerals like iron oxide, copper oxide, and manganese dioxide were used to create a range of brown colors.
- Insects: Insects like cochineal and lac were used to create a deep, rich brown color.

What are the key factors that affect the color and quality of brown dye?
The color and quality of brown dye are influenced by several key factors, including the type and quality of the dye, the type of fabric being dyed, the temperature and time of the dyeing process, and the presence of any auxiliary chemicals or additives. The type and quality of the dye will determine the intensity, tone, and lightfastness of the brown color, while the type of fabric will affect the way the dye binds to the fibers and the overall appearance of the final product. The temperature and time of the dyeing process will also impact the color and quality of the brown dye, as higher temperatures and longer dyeing times can lead to deeper, richer colors, but also increase the risk of over-dyeing or uneven color distribution.
Other factors that can affect the color and quality of brown dye include the pH level of the dyeing solution, the presence of impurities or contaminants in the water or fabric, and the use of fixatives or other auxiliary chemicals. By carefully controlling these factors and optimizing the dyeing process, individuals can achieve consistent, high-quality results and create a wide range of brown shades with unique characteristics and properties. What are the common mistakes to avoid when working with brown dye?
When working with brown dye, there are several common mistakes to avoid, including using the wrong type of dye for the fabric being dyed, failing to properly prepare the fabric before dyeing, and not controlling the temperature and time of the dyeing process. Using the wrong type of dye can result in uneven color distribution, poor lightfastness, or other issues, while failing to prepare the fabric can lead to inconsistent colors or poor dye binding. Not controlling the temperature and time of the dyeing process can also lead to over-dyeing or under-dyeing, resulting in colors that are too dark or too light.
Other common mistakes to avoid when working with brown dye include not testing the dye on a small sample of fabric before dyeing larger quantities, not using the correct ratio of dye to water, and not properly rinsing and washing the dyed fabric to remove excess dye and fixatives. What are the best ways to care for and maintain brown-dyed fabrics to ensure their color and quality last?
To care for and maintain brown-dyed fabrics and ensure their color and quality last, it is essential to follow proper washing and drying procedures. This includes washing the fabric in cold water, using a mild detergent, and avoiding exposure to direct sunlight or high temperatures. It is also important to avoid using bleach or other harsh chemicals, as these can damage the fabric or cause the color to fade. Instead, using a gentle soap or detergent specifically designed for washing dyed fabrics can help to maintain the color and texture of the fabric.
Regular maintenance and care can also help to extend the life of brown-dyed fabrics and preserve their color and quality. This includes storing the fabric in a cool, dry place, away from direct sunlight, and avoiding exposure to moisture or humidity. Ironing or steaming the fabric can also help to restore its texture and appearance, but it is essential to use a low heat setting and avoid scorching or burning the fabric.
